I've stayed at Bell's Motor Lodge in Spearfish a couple of times when I'm passing through. I attended a FJR rally there in 2015 and I'm booked to go back again for a FJR / Dual sport rally in 2018. Its a reasonably priced well kept old school motel where you can park your bike outside your door. Scott, the owner operator has been pretty accommodating in the past.

I've contacted Motels & for warned them of what's happening. It is up to YOU to make your own reservations, I'm not doing it. Rates vary from $59.00 - $125.00 If you double up prices will be cheaper per person, it's up to you.

JC's Stagestop B&B has limited amount of beds. When they're full, she will contact me & we'll work out someplace else to stay. They do have space for about 7 cots, Marlene & I will be using them. It's really a great place to stay so I wouldn't procrastinate.

Tipperary Motel in Buffalo is the only lodging in the area. The closest lodging is all the way back to Belle Fourche.

When making your reservations, tell them you are with the GLMC group.

Your reservations should be made at the following motels for the date listed.

September 9th....Buffalo Ridge Inn, Custer, SD 605-717-7006
Hi Jack, Below is my direct number to call. We have 15% Advance Purchase Rate and 10% off AAA. I am in tomorrow and off Friday and Saturday, back on Sunday. They can also leave a voicemail my direct line. Thanks Donna Heaton


September 10th...JC Stagestop Aladdin, WY 307-896-9134

September 11th...Tipperary Motel, Buffalo, SD 605-375-3721

September 12th...Bell's Motor Lodge, Spearfish, SD 605-642-3812

September 13th...Spring Creek Inn, Hill City, SD 605-574-2591

September 14th..Skyline Motel, Hot Springs, SD 605-745-6980
